Popular State Parks Near Three Lakes, FL

Explore Underwater Wonders: John Pennekamp Coral Reef State Park in Florida is renowned for its vibrant coral reefs and diverse marine life. Snorkel or scuba dive to witness colorful coral formations and tropical fish species. Take a glass-bottom boat tour for a unique perspective without getting wet. Nature trails allow exploration of mangrove swamps and tropical hammocks while kayaking or canoeing immerses you in the serene beauty of mangrove forests. Campgrounds offer RV accommodations, and fishing opportunities abound.Tropical Paradise: Long Key State Park in the Florida Keys invites RV enthusiasts to a secluded haven amidst lush foliage. With 60 campsites offering water and electricity hookups, it's perfect for RV camping. Enjoy over a mile of sandy beaches for swimming, sunbathing, or snorkeling. Explore hiking trails through the park's natural beauty, go fishing, watch wildlife, kayak, paddleboard, and visit nearby attractions.Little Crawl Key Retreat: Curry Hammock State Park nestled between Marathon and Key West offers 28 spacious RV campsites with full hookups. Enjoy stunning beaches for swimming and sunbathing. Try kayaking, paddleboarding, or snorkeling in crystal-clear waters. Nature trails wind through hammocks teeming with wildlife. Fishing opportunities abound.Deep Bay Getaway: Bahia Honda State Park in the Florida Keys boasts beautiful palm trees, scenic beaches, and clear water, perfect for swimming and snorkeling. Campgrounds offer RV sites with water and electrical hookups; cabins are also available. Explore trails for hiking and biking or enjoy fishing opportunities at this picturesque retreat.

Must-see Monuments and Landmarks Near Three Lakes, FL

Big Cypress National Preserve: Immerse yourself in the diverse wilderness of Big Cypress National Preserve. Covering over 729,000 acres, this preserve offers RVers and campers a unique experience with cypress swamps, pine forests, and prairies. Explore the abundant wildlife, go fishing and stargaze, and enjoy recreational activities like hiking and biking.De Soto National Memorial: Step back in time at De Soto National Memorial. Learn about the landing site of Spanish explorer Hernando de Soto in 1539 through exhibits at the visitor center. Explore nature trails for scenic views of Manatee River and enjoy picnicking amidst natural beauty. Join ranger-led programs to delve deeper into history and spot coastal creatures.Canaveral National Seashore: Experience the stunning coastal beauty of Canaveral National Seashore. RV camping is available at three campgrounds, including one right on Playalinda Beach. Discover diverse ecosystems, swim, fish, hike, and visit historic sites like Eldora State House. These national sites near Three Lakes provide opportunities for outdoor adventures and appreciation of Florida's natural wonders.

RVshare’s Top Picks for Nearby RV Parks & Campgrounds

Encore Miami Everglades: This RV campground in Three Lakes, Florida offers full hookups for both 30 and 50 Amp. You'll find a pool, hot tub, volleyball and basketball courts, a camp store, Wi-Fi, and a boardwalk. Showers are available, and pets are allowed. The cell reception here is strong.Boardwalk RV Resort: Located near Three Lakes, this campground has over 230 back-in sites with full hookups for both 30 and 50 Amp. They have a pool, laundry facilities, and showers, and pets are welcome. Good Sam, AAA, Passport America, FQCC, and military discounts are available.Southern Comfort RV Resort: With daily rates starting at $46 near Three Lakes in Florida this resort offers full hookups for both 30 and 50 Amp. They have back-in and pull-through sites available along with a pool/hot tub combo. Showers are also available along with laundry facilities and Wi-Fi. Pets are welcome here too.

RV Dump Stations Near Three Lakes, FL

When it comes to dumping in Three Lakes, Florida, you have a few options. You can find dump stations at Pilot/Flying J, C.B. Smith Park, Markham Park (Broward County Park), and Markham Park.These dump stations provide facilities for dumping black water and gray water, as well as fresh water for flushing tanks. Additionally, you'll find RV trash bins and waste disposal areas to help keep your RV clean and tidy during your stay in Three Lakes.
